Leading under Pressure (Xlibris Publishing), a revolutionary new book by Gabriela Cora, MD, MBA, addresses the many challenges that corporate executives, successful entrepreneurs, and road-warriors face in their daily responsibilities. Dr. Cora, a medical doctor with an MBA, brilliantly blends her considerable knowledge in the fields of corporate business and medicine to helm up a self-help book that offers effective strategies to maximize peak performance and productivity, while maximizing health and well-being. A masterful fusion of effective business strategies and health strategies, this sterling work is based on a practical reality: everyone who is proactively working on achieving success, leading busy lives, managing others to achieve and succeed will benefit from reading this book. Whether you are a business owner, a politician, a professional, or a corporate executive, leading under pressure is a part of everyday life.

Dr. Cora's revolutionary work appeals to the quick attention focus of those who are constantly leading under pressure, a practical guide as to where you stand within the stress and well-being continua, a review of facts of the spectrum of health and disease, and an assessment and strategic matrix of individual and organizational health as it relates to productivity and performance.

About the Author

In addition to being a physician, Dr. Gabriela Cora is also a master's in business administration. As a corporate consultant and business coach, Dr. Cora has assisted clients resolving complex critical issues and improving their performance and productivity at work. Since practically all successful entrepreneurs or business owners struggle with juggling it all at any time in their lives, the author was inspired to create Leading under Pressure to provide a comprehensive program that integrated the needs to improve productivity and performance while maximizing health and well-being.
